Book Overview

The Cosmopolitan is a book written by John Brisben Walker in 1904. It is a collection of articles and essays that were originally published in the magazine of the same name, which Walker owned and edited. The book covers a wide range of topics, including politics, culture, and society. It also includes interviews with famous figures of the time, such as Theodore Roosevelt and Mark Twain. The Cosmopolitan was a popular magazine in the early 20th century, known for its progressive and forward-thinking content.
